About this listen
"I like you collared, baby. I like you naked, I like you mine."
Ellie Stevens has lusted over Kayne Roberts since he first walked into the import/export company she works for a little over a year ago. As Expo's most important client, Ellie has always kept a safe distance from the man with the majestic blue eyes - until temptation finally gets the better of her. Impulsively, Ellie invites Kayne to one of Expo's infamous company parties her flamboyant boss is notorious for throwing. Unbeknownst to Ellie, the god in the Armani suit isn't just the suave entrepreneur he portrays himself to be. Underneath the professional exterior is a man with a secret life, dark desires, and nefarious contacts.
In a hidden corner of a trendy New York City lounge, the spark kindling between the two of them ignites. Unable to resist the sinful attraction, Ellie agrees to leave with Kayne, believing she is finally bedding the man of her dreams. Little does she know when she walks out the door, she's about to be Owned.
Content warning: Owned is a dark erotic romance. Please pay close attention to the use of the words dark, erotic, and romance. It has intense sexual situations, a Master/slave relationship, mild abuse, and some violence. Listener discretion is advised.

The story follows Ellie and Kayne, two central characters whose development unfolds gradually over the course of the book. Ellie’s arc is structured and consistent, and her progression feels intentional rather than rushed. Kayne is presented as a complex and conflicted figure, and while not always easy to understand, his role within the story adds depth and contrast. Their interactions are purposeful and drive much of the plot forward.
One of the strengths of this audiobook is its pacing. Subtle clues are layered into the narrative, encouraging the listener to stay engaged and consider how events may connect. While there are hints along the way, the ending still manages to shift perspective and add context to earlier moments without relying on unnecessary complexity.
The narration by Sam Crowley and Muffy Newtown is clear and well balanced. Both narrators deliver consistent performances that suit the tone of the story and help distinguish character viewpoints. The audio production itself is clean and easy to follow, making this a comfortable listen.
By the conclusion, the book clearly sets up interest in the next instalment, particularly in seeing how the characters move forward from the events of this story. A supporting character, Jett, also stands out and may appeal to listeners interested in future developments within the series.
Listeners should note that the content warnings are relevant and worth reviewing prior to listening.
Overall, Owned is a well-executed audiobook with strong narration, structured storytelling, and enough intrigue to encourage continuing the series.
